Android Smartphones assisting visually impaired:

Catch Notes:


This is the very basic note-taking app as well as it works amazingly for memo app. It might be a daunting task for some people to attempt for taking notes using the touch-screen phones, especially when the user is visually challenged. The compatibility of this app with Google’s recognition software is such that it can swiftly transcribe the natural speech in the real time. This is also great for the budding novelists and also imagines the occasional lapses at the accuracy.

Magnify:

In order to read the tiny prints, this app will work the best for assisting the individuals. One can also acquire the best results, by keeping their cell-phones at 4 inches of distance from the material to be read. One can also turn the flashlight to on and off mode so as to save the battery. The app will support the best of features including double tap for zoom in and zoom out, single tap to maintain focus and long press to turn lights on and off.

Ideal Accessibility Installer:

This is an Android App Development which is amazing for installing the bunch of accessibility programs directly from the Google such as KickBack, SoundBack and TalkBack apps. The app is extremely amazing for automatically installing the apps for all the visually impaired as they provide feedbacks for each user actions. For an instance, Talkback app will also notify the users for each action performed on screen by employing the click button and swiping the screen. The user will also get the notification for every new messages which can be read out of the app.

Font Installer Root:

It is kind of challenge for the users to tackle the smartphones with the small screen. Smartphones usually have 4 inches of screen space that will be surely inconvenient for the users who have eyesight issues, especially while reading the texts. There is also a font; Font Installer Root that will enable all the users to avail over 100 of fonts so that they can read the text clearly.
